Each faculty member in the Pamplin School of Business is dedicated to continually improving his or her curriculum to include cutting edge technology, social media, and the latest academic research developments in their classes. The quantity and quality of research by the Pamplin School of Business faculty is impressive. Click here to see a sampling of their recent publications and presentations.
In addition to being outstanding scholars, our faculty are leading innovators, consultants, and advisors. They include Arjun Chatrath, the Art Schulte Distinguished Professor who is recognized as one of the world's top finance research scholars by the Journal of Finance Literature, and Bahram Adrangi, who, in August 2012, was named the first Walter E Nelson Distinguished Professor.
